Music by Deborah Wicks La Puma
Based on the book "The Story of Ferdinand" by Munro Leaf & Robert Lawson
The story of the little bull who just wanted to sit and smell the flowers...
Featuring Peter O'Brien as Ferdinand the bull, Donna Cotter as Cochina, Ferdinand's piggy friend, Christopher Michelin as Duke Dodo and Blake Young as the duke's son, Danilo, plus youth actors from Footprint Theatre, flamenco dancers choreographed by Veronica Valderrama and live accoustic music performed by Dave Crowden and Guitarama.
Outdoor summer theatre everyone can enjoy!
Shows at 10am on 4,5,6,7,8,9 January and at 4pm on 8,9 January 2011.
